Much cooler air on-the-move; no shortage of rainfall for much of the Nation

Looking ahead, the 6- to 10-day outlook calls for the likelihood of below-normal temperatures between the Rockies and Appalachians, while warmer-than-normal weather will be confined to southern Texas, areas along the Atlantic Coast, and the Far West.
